The LYCRA Company Makes NSC Safety Congress & Expo Debut

Highlights Innovative Fibers That Enhance Worker Comfort, Performance, and Protection

WILMINGTON, Del.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--The LYCRA Company, a global leader in developing fiber and technology solutions for the apparel and personal care industries, today announced its inaugural exhibition at the NSC Safety Congress & Expo, being held September 14-16 in Indianapolis. The company also marks the North American debut of its “FIBERS THAT WORK” portfolio of innovative solutions for workwear, uniforms, and protective apparel.

"Comfort is fundamental to workwear performance," said Tara Maurer-Mackay, product category director, branded specialty products at The LYCRA Company. "Our innovations help workers adapt to changing conditions throughout the day with fibers that move moisture to keep them dry if they sweat, stretch that allows them to move freely, and solutions that enhance visibility for safety. Leveraging our decades of innovation in comfort technologies, we are uniquely positioned to help our customers create garments that workers can trust in demanding environments."

The LYCRA Company will spotlight performance solutions for key workwear challenges, including moisture management, visibility, anti-static protection, and durability.

  • LYCRA® ANTISTATIC fiber provides inherent anti-static performance while delivering the lasting comfort and fit expected from the LYCRA® brand.
  • LYCRA® T400® fiber creates durable fabrics for workers that offer comfort stretch, a consistent fit, moisture management, and withstand up to 100 industrial washes.

These are a few of the innovations in the expanding FIBERS THAT WORK portfolio, reflecting growing demand for workwear solutions that combine protection, comfort, durability, and sustainability benefits, including products made with recycled and renewable materials.

About The LYCRA Company

The LYCRA Company innovates and produces fiber and technology solutions for the apparel and personal care industries and owns the leading consumer brands: LYCRA®, LYCRA HyFit®, LYCRA® T400®, COOLMAX®, THERMOLITE®, ELASPAN®, SUPPLEX® and TACTEL®. Headquartered in Wilmington, Delaware, U.S., The LYCRA Company is recognized worldwide for its high-quality products, technical expertise, and marketing support. The LYCRA Company focuses on adding value to its customers’ products by developing unique innovations designed to meet the consumer’s need for comfort and lasting performance.
